引言

            区块链技术作为一个革命性的创新,正在迅速改变许多行业的面貌。无论是在金融、供应链管理、医疗健康还是数字身份认证等领域,区块链都展现出了巨大的潜力。然而,随着区块链项目的增加,确保工作质量和安全性变得尤为重要。本文将深入探讨区块链工作需要注意的事项,并提供一系列最佳实践,旨在帮助企业和开发者在区块链项目中取得成功。

            1. 深入理解区块链技术

            区块链工作注意事项与最佳实践指南

            首先,了解区块链技术的基本原理和机制是至关重要的。区块链是一种去中心化的分布式账本技术,通过加密算法和共识机制确保数据的安全性与完整性。在从事任何与区块链相关的工作之前,务必要具备对其核心概念的清晰理解,如智能合约、共识算法、加密货币等。

            此外,在区块链项目中,区块链的类型(如公有链、私有链和联盟链),以及选择合适的区块链平台(如Ethereum, Hyperledger等)也非常重要。每种区块链都有其独特的特性和适用场景,因此了解不同类型区块链的优缺点,可以帮助团队做出更加明智的决策。

            2. 强调安全性

            在区块链工作中,安全性是一个不可忽视的因素。由于区块链网络的开放性和透明度,安全漏洞和攻击成为了项目成功与否的关键因素。因此,在开发和实施区块链解决方案时,确保系统的安全性是首要任务。

            首先,采用最佳的安全实践,包括使用强密码、实施多重身份验证,以及定期进行安全审计。同时,区块链开发者需要关注智能合约的漏洞,由于智能合约一旦部署便无法更改,确保其代码的严格性和安全性显得尤为重要。

            此外,保持对最新的安全威胁和攻击手法的了解,以便迅速适应并采取适当的防护措施,是保障区块链安全的另一重要方面。

            3. 务实的项目管理

            区块链工作注意事项与最佳实践指南

            有效的项目管理是区块链项目成功的基础。在区块链工作中,通常需要跨学科团队的通力合作,从开发者到项目经理,再到业务分析师,确保团队成员之间的沟通畅通无阻至关重要。

            采用敏捷开发的方法论,可以帮助团队更灵活地响应变化并提高工作效率。在每个迭代周期中,根据客户反馈不断产品,可以确保最终交付的解决方案符合用户需求。

            此外,设定合理的里程碑和目标,以便实时监控项目进度,不断调整计划,确保项目按时完成并符合质量标准。

            4. 遵循规范与合规性

            在进行区块链工作时,了解并遵循相关的法律法规也是必要的。由于区块链的技术特性,涉及数据隐私、用户安全等多方面的法律问题。因此,在推出任何基于区块链的产品或服务之前,需要确保符合当地和国际的法律要求。

            例如,对于涉及用户个人数据的区块链项目,区块链工作者应遵循GDPR(一般数据保护条例)的要求,确保用户的隐私受到保护。同时,了解并遵循金融监管、反洗钱和反恐融资等方面的法律,也能降低法律风险。

            5. 开展教育与培训

            随着区块链技术的迅猛发展,很多员工可能对其了解有限。因此,开展相关的教育与培训活动,可以帮助团队成员提升对区块链的认识,进而提升工作效率。定期组织培训、研讨会或者分享会,让团队成员共享最新的技术动态与案例分析,能够有效激发创新和提高工作积极性。

            此外,鼓励团队成员自我学习,通过阅读、在线课程等方式,提升自身技术水平和行业认知,也是非常必要的。建立一个知识共享的文化,可以极大地促进团队的整体发展。

            相关区块链的安全性如何保障?

            在区块链技术的应用中,安全性是尤为重要的一环。无法忽视的是,任何技术都存在潜在的安全风险。在区块链前沿的项目中,确保其安全性是预防损失的关键。

            首先,开发安全的智能合约是保障安全性的第一步。智能合约是自动执行合约条款的计算机程序,任何简单的编码错误都能导致巨大的损失。因此,在编写智能合约时,采用编程语言的标准实践,使用已经经过行业验证的库和工具,可以大大降低风险。

            接下来,区块链网络的共识机制也非常重要。通过广播式和共识机制,确保所有参与者都认可数据的真实性,流行的共识机制如工作量证明(PoW)和权益证明(PoS)都能够有效防止数据的篡改和双重支付。

            及时更新网络节点和算法也是保障安全的重要措施。安全研究者不断发现新的攻击手段,因此定期更新和修补系统漏洞,可以减少潜在的攻击机会。

            相关区块链的最佳实践有哪些?

            对于区块链开发者和企业来说,遵循最佳实践是实现项目成功的关键。首先,明确项目的目标和业务需求是最佳实践的起点。所有的设计和开发都应围绕着用户需求进行,通过明确的目标来指导开发过程。

            其次,确保技术选择的合理性,同样是成功的关键。兼容性、性能和可扩展性都是在选择区块链平台时需要综合考虑的因素。对比不同平台的优缺点,选择最适合项目需求的技术。

            建立一套完善的测试机制,确保所有功能的正常运行。进行单元测试、集成测试和用户验收测试,都是保障产品质量的必要步骤。同时,及时收集用户反馈,不断迭代更新,有效提升用户体验。

            相关如何进行有效的项目管理?

            有效的项目管理是成功的保证。首先,初期的需求分析和项目规划极为重要。项目经理需要统筹考虑各方需求,在项目启动前清晰定义项目的范围、目标和主要里程碑,以确保后续工作的顺利进行。

            其次,采用合适的项目管理工具和方法论,如敏捷或瀑布模型,根据项目的规模和复杂度进行合理选择。敏捷开发可以帮助快速响应用户变化,提高交付效率。

            尤其是在区块链工作中,由于涉及技术的持续变化和更新,项目经理需要定期与团队沟通,确保信息透明、任务明确,及时解决遇到的问题。

            相关未来区块链工作的发展趋势是什么?

            区块链技术正处于快速发展的阶段,其未来的发展趋势值得关注。首先,代币化和数字资产化将在各行业普遍应用。通过资产的数字化,简化交易过程,提高资金的流动性和透明度,促进跨境投资。

            其次,隐私保护技术将迎来更大的发展。个人数据的隐私保护在区块链中显得尤为重要,未来将会有更多的隐私保护协议和技术如zk-SNARKs等应用于区块链中。

            最后,去中心化金融(DeFi)和去中心化自治组织(DAO)的兴起,将会改变金融行业和企业管理的传统模式。基于区块链的智能合约,将会重构传统金融体系,实现无中介的直接交易。

            总结

            区块链作为一项创新技术,给世界带来了巨大的变革,但与之相伴的也是许多挑战。本文总结了在区块链工作中需要关注的注意事项,包括深刻理解技术、安全性、项目管理、合规性以及团队教育。还探讨了区块链工作可能面临的一些相关问题,通过对这些问题的详细解答,帮助大家更好地应对区块链工作中的各种挑战。只有通过严谨的态度和科学的方法论,才能使区块链技术真正发挥其潜力,引领未来的发展。